Diversity Of Endophytic Fungi From Bryophytes,Pteridophytes And Spermatophytes Collected From The Dawei Mountain,Southwest China

The microorganisms that cause asymptomatic infections in living plant tissues have been called endophytes.They formed complicated symbiotic relationship during the long process of co-evolution.According to the archaeological discovery,endophytes have existed in the plant before 400 million years ago,which makes people to think that endophytes may have played an important role in the process of plants transition from aquatic environment to terrestrial environment as well as in the process of evolution from lower plant species to higher species.However,there is little researches on it until now.Dawei Mountain,which located in Yunnan Province,Southwest China,is the only and the most comprehensive region which has humid rainforests and the tropical mountain forests perpendicular band series in mainland China and it has never been attacked by "the quaternary glacier" in the geological history,so it can provide research materials with the historical continuity.For this reason,14 plant species[Bryophyte(Mnium sp.,Marchantia polymorpha,Polytrichum commune,Hylocomium splendens),Pteridophyte(Plagiogyria maxima,Alsophila costularis,Diacalpe aspidioides,Coniogramme petelotii,Asplenium normale),Spermatophyte(Taiwania cryptomerioides,Cunninghamia lanceolata,Embelia polypodioides,Vernonia saligna,Rhododendron irroratum)]were collected from Dawei Mountain and their endophytic fungi were isolated,and fungal endophytic diversity between plants in different evolutional degree were compared.The results are as follows:(1)A total of 3526 culturable endophytic fungi were isolated from 2640 segments of 14 plant species,and the colonization rate,isolation rate and the Shannon Indices ranged from 93.75%to 100%,1.01 to 1.95 and 1.74 to 3.22,respectively.The results indicated that the endophytic fungi diversity in this region is very high.(2)There is no significant difference in fungal endophytic isolation rate between photosynthesis tissues and rhizoid tissues of bryophytes,however,it showed significant difference among roots,stems and leaves of pteridophytes.It suggested that the richness of endophytic fungi changed with the improvement of the plant and tissue differentiation.(3)Based on morphological characteristics and 18S rDNA sequence analyses,all of the isolates were identified to 68 taxa,of which Xylaria sp.and Collectotrichurn sp.were the dominant genera.In addition,they displayed some specificity or preferences in the individual and tissue level.(4)The Shannon Indices of 14 plant species ranged from 0.409 to 0.756,indicating that fungal endophytes community of plants in Dawei Mountain are similar in a certain extent.Moreover,we found that the Shannon Indices of plants having closer evolutional degree is higher than that of plants having further evolutional degree,and the isolation rate of some fungal endophytic taxa(Penicillium sp.,Trichoderma sp.,etc.)were lowered and others(Phomopsis sp.,Nigrospora oryzae,etc.)were increased with plants' evolution.(5)We found that the intraspecific genetic diversity of the dominant endophytic fungi-Xylaria was very rich through 18S r DNA analysis.Moreover,it was found that the group A only was isolated from spermatophytes,which suggested that some endophytic fungi only associated with the host plants in a certain evolutional degree.However,to verify this,more work need to do in the future.
